AI Summary

SB3614 Summary

  • Lowers the age threshold for Tier 2 monthly retirement annuity increases from age 60 to age 55 for Chicago police officers and firefighters hired on or after specific dates.

  • Changes annual annuity increases for Tier 2 retirees from a variable rate (3% or half of consumer price index-u, whichever is less) to a fixed 3% of the originally granted retirement annuity.

  • Eliminates the annuity reduction factor for police officers and firefighters retiring after age 50 with 20 or more years of creditable service under Tier 2.

  • Allows retired officers and firefighters with 10 or more years but less than 20 years of service who reach age 50 to qualify for Tier 2 monthly retirement annuities without early retirement reductions.

  • Exempts implementation of the bill from State Mandates Act reimbursement requirements.
